Here are some tips for after you get your nipples pierced:
Try not to touch or play with your new piercings too much, as this can irritate them and cause infection.
It’s important to avoid playing with or touching your new nipple piercings too much, as this can lead to irritation and infection. Give them time to heal properly and resist the urge to fiddle with them – your patience will be rewarded with beautiful and healthy piercings.
Wash your hands thoroughly before touching or cleaning your piercings.
It is important to wash your hands thoroughly before touching or cleaning your nipple piercings for a few reasons.
First, you want to avoid introducing any bacteria or other contaminants to the piercing site which could lead to infection.
Secondly, if your hands are dirty it can irritate the piercing and cause discomfort.
Finally, it is just good hygiene practice to wash your hands before coming into contact with anything that will go into your body!
Use mild soap and warm water to clean your piercings twice a day.
To clean your nipple piercings, use mild soap and warm water. Cleanse the area around your piercing twice a day to avoid infection. Use a soft cloth or cotton swab to gently clean the piercing. Avoid using harsh chemicals or scrubbing the area. After cleaning, make sure to dry the area thoroughly.
Avoid using harsh chemicals, lotions, or perfumes near your piercings.
Another thing to keep in mind is to avoid using harsh chemicals, lotions, or perfumes near your nipple piercings. This can cause irritation and potentially damage the piercing. Instead, opt for gentle cleansing products that will not irritate the area. Why should you avoid using chemicals, lotions, or perfumes?
You should avoid using chemicals, lotions, or perfumes near your nipple piercing area for a few reasons. First, chemicals can irritate the area and cause discomfort. Second, lotions and perfumes can make the area more susceptible to infection. Finally, they can slow down the healing process.
Make sure to dry your piercings thoroughly after cleansing them.
After you clean your piercings, it is important to make sure that they are completely dry. This will help to prevent infection and will keep your piercings looking their best. Use a clean, soft towel to gently pat your piercings dry. If you have any concerns about your piercings, or if they seem to be getting infected, be sure to consult with a professional piercer.
If you experience any redness, swelling, discharge, or pain, contact your piercing artist or doctor.
If you experience any redness, swelling, discharge, or pain after getting a piercing, it’s important to contact your piercing artist or doctor. These could be signs of an infection, and it’s better to err on the side of caution than to ignore potential problems.
